Technical Field
The utility model relates to the technical field of plastic composite bag production lines, in particular to a winding device of a plastic composite bag production line.
Background
Plastic bags are an indispensable article in people's daily life and are often used for containing other articles. The plastic bag is widely used because of the advantages of low cost, light weight, large capacity and convenient storage, but is forbidden to be produced and used in part of countries because of the defects of extremely long degradation period and difficult treatment. Therefore, the problem of repeated use of plastic bags has been paid attention to, and in the technology of making plastic bags, when the plastic composite bags are manufactured in advance, the plastic bags are usually required to be rolled up, so as to be convenient for collection and placement, and the next step of discharging for quality inspection work.
According to the Chinese patent publication No. CN215551361U, a winding device of a plastic composite bag production line is disclosed, and the technical scheme is as follows: the novel winding machine comprises a base, a support is arranged at the top end of the base, a rotating motor is arranged on the side face of the support, a winding roller is arranged on the rotating motor through a rotating shaft, a plurality of winding teeth are arranged on the winding roller, moving grooves penetrating through two sides are formed in the support, the rotating shaft is arranged in the moving grooves, two screws perpendicular to the base are arranged on the side face of the support, a first moving block and a second moving block are respectively arranged on the screws, a moving plate is arranged on the side face of the first moving block, and the rotating motor is fixedly arranged on the moving plate.
The plastic composite bag winding device is simple in structure aiming at the prior art, the plastic composite bag is easy to loose in winding materials after winding is finished, winding efficiency is reduced and improved, the plastic composite bag winding device has the advantage of being convenient for controlling the thickness of the wound plastic composite bag, and another solution is provided for the defects in the patent application.

Detailed Description
The following description of the embodiments of the present utility model will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present utility model, but not all embodiments. All other embodiments, which can be made by those skilled in the art based on the embodiments of the utility model without making any inventive effort, are intended to be within the scope of the utility model.
Referring to fig. 1-3, a winding device of a plastic composite bag production line in this embodiment includes a processing table 1, a winding frame 2, a rotating motor 3 and a winding roller 4, and a winding mechanism 5 is disposed at the top of the processing table 1.
The winding mechanism 5 comprises limiting blocks 501 which are clamped on the outer peripheral wall of the winding roller 4 and are four in number, the limiting blocks 501 are arc-shaped, two adjacent limiting blocks 501 form a circular ring, the inner peripheral wall of the circular ring is matched with the outer peripheral wall of the winding roller 4 in size, a rubber block is fixedly arranged on the outer wall of one side, far away from the winding frame 2, of each limiting block 501, two mounting blocks 502 are fixedly arranged on the outer wall of each limiting block 501, fixing screws 503 are connected with the inner threads of the two adjacent mounting blocks 502, thread grooves are formed in the inner portions of the two mounting blocks 502, the fixing screws 503 are in threaded connection with the inner portions of the two adjacent thread grooves, and the outer peripheral wall of each fixing screw 503 is in threaded connection with a nut.
The processing platform 1 bottom and the equal fixed mounting of bottom outer wall have dead lever 504, the top outer wall fixed mounting of dead lever 504 has servo motor 505, servo motor 505's output shaft fixed mounting has two-way threaded rod 506, the peripheral wall threaded connection of two-way threaded rod 506 has connecting seat 507, the spout has been seted up to two opposite side outer walls of dead lever 504, connecting seat 507 is at the inside sliding connection of spout and big or small looks adaptation, fixed mounting has connecting rod 508 between two homonymy connecting seats 507, the front side outer wall fixed mounting of rear side connecting rod 508 has extension rod 509, the equal fixed mounting of extension rod 509 and the opposite side outer wall of front side connecting rod 508 has heat sealing machine 510.
The inside of the processing table 1 is provided with perforations, the length and the width of the perforations are the same as those of the heat sealing machine 510, the length and the width of the extension rod 509 are the same as those of the heat sealing machine 510, the front side outer wall of the processing table 1 is fixedly provided with two positioning plates 511, and the distance between the opposite sides of the two positioning plates 511 is the same as that of the heat sealing machine 510.
In this embodiment, two rolling frames 2 are fixedly installed on the front outer wall of the processing table 1, a rotating motor 3 is fixedly installed on the top outer wall of the top rolling frame 2, and a rolling roller 4 is rotatably installed between the two rolling frames 2.
In this embodiment, the same side refers to the top or bottom.
In this embodiment, when the two heat sealing machines 510 do not seal the plastic composite bag, a certain distance needs to be kept between the two heat sealing machines and the plastic composite bag, so that the heat sealing machines 510 and the plastic composite bag are prevented from being damaged.
In this embodiment, the limiting block 501 is used for limiting and fixing according to the width of the plastic composite bag, so as to be convenient for winding the plastic composite bag.
In this embodiment, the positioning plate 511 can position and limit the plastic composite bag.
The working principle of the embodiment is as follows:
firstly, two adjacent limiting blocks 501 are fixed on the peripheral wall of the wind-up roll 4 through the functions of the mounting blocks 502 and the fixing screws 503, then limiting fixation is carried out on the plastic composite bag, when the opening of the plastic composite bag is about to pass through the heat sealing machine 510, the servo motor 505 can drive the bidirectional threaded rod 506 to rotate, at the moment, two connecting seats 507 which are in threaded connection with the bidirectional threaded rod 506 can synchronously move towards the direction of the processing table 1, at the moment, the connecting seats 507 can synchronously drive the connecting rod 508, the extension rod 509 and the heat sealing machine 510 to synchronously move, at the moment, the two heat sealing machines 510 can heat-seal the opening of the plastic composite bag.
In the second embodiment, on the basis of the first embodiment, a rubber block is provided, and the rubber block is fixedly installed on the outer wall of the side, far away from the winding frame 2, of the limiting block 501, so that friction force between the plastic composite bag and the limiting block 501 can be increased, and the plastic composite bag is prevented from loosening during winding.
